Abstract:
OBJECTIVE: We assessed the utility of red blood cell (RBC) CD105 and side scatter (SSC) parameters by flow cytometry for the detection of low-grade myelodysplastic neoplasms (MDS) in bone marrow specimens.
METHODS: Ten RBC parameters incorporating CD105 or SSC combined with the Meyerson-Alayed scoring system (MASS) metrics were retrospectively evaluated by flow cytometry for utility in detecting low-grade MDS (n = 56) compared with cytopenic controls (n = 86).
RESULTS: Myelodysplastic neoplasms were associated with 7 of the RBC parameters in univariate analysis. Multivariate analysis using cutoff values based on optimal and 95% specificity levels of the RBC metrics and the MASS parameters revealed the SSC ratio of CD105-positive and CD105-negative RBC fractions (CD105+/- SSC); the percentage and coefficient of variation of the CD105-positive fraction of RBCs (CD105%, CD105+CV) emerged as significant RBC variables. Two simple scoring schemes using these RBC values along with MASS parameters were identified: 1 using CD105+/- SSC, CD105%, and CD105+CV combined with the percentage of CD177-positive granulocytes (CD177%), myeloblast percentage (CD34%), and granulocyte SSC (GranSSC), and the other incorporating CD105+/- SSC, CD105+CV, CD177%, CD34%, GranSSC, and B-cell progenitor percentage. Both demonstrated a sensitivity of approximately 80%, with a specificity of roughly 90% for the detection of MDS compared with cytopenic controls.
CONCLUSIONS: The red blood cell parameter, CD105+/- SSC, appears to be beneficial in the evaluation of low-grade MDS by flow cytometry.
摘要:
目的:我们通过流式细胞术评估了红细胞(RBC)CD105和侧向散射(SSC)参数在检测骨髓标本中低级别骨髓增生异常肿瘤(MDS)中的实用性。
方法:通过流式细胞术回顾性评估结合CD105或SSC与Meyerson-Alayed评分系统(MASS)指标的10个RBC参数在检测低度MDS(n=56)中的实用性。
结果:单因素分析中骨髓增生异常肿瘤与7个红细胞参数相关。使用基于RBC指标和MASS参数的最佳和95%特异性水平的截止值进行多变量分析,揭示了CD105阳性和CD105阴性RBC分数的SSC比率(CD105/-SSC);RBC的CD105阳性分数的百分比和变异系数(CD105%,CD105+CV)作为显著的RBC变量出现。确定了使用这些RBC值以及MASS参数的两个简单评分方案:1使用CD105+/-SSC,CD105%,和CD105+CV与CD177阳性粒细胞的百分比(CD177%),成髓细胞百分比(CD34%),和粒细胞SSC(GranSSC),另一个结合了CD105+/-SSC,CD105+CV,CD177%,CD34%,GranSSC,和B细胞祖细胞百分比。两者都表现出大约80%的灵敏度,与细胞减少性对照相比,MDS检测的特异性约为90%。
结论:红细胞参数,CD105+/-SSC,通过流式细胞术评估低度MDS似乎是有益的。
